Finally, keeping with this Blogging Theme, we created two new Widgets and placed them in a plugin folder for easy installation (on a Frugal powered site or any other WordPress website).
One of the Widgets is an Author Profile Widget. What this does is provide you with a super easy way to display any author in a Widget area, showing their Gravatar, creating a Bio and even displaying a “Read more” link to take visitors to a more in-depth author page. The other Widget is a Banner Ad Widget that provides a simple, easy to use tool for displaying 125×125 Banner Ads in your sidebar, spacing them out perfectly. It also provides an option to display an “Advertise Here” banner, linked to whichever ad page you like (on or off your site) and even an option to choose whether or not it opens in a new window.

Frugal 3.5.5 – Staying ahead of the game
Since the early releases of WordPress 3.0 Beta, The Frugal Team has been constantly monitoring the WordPress Core Code to ensure that Frugal is fully compatible with all the fantastic new functionality.
We launched Frugal 3.5 while WordPress was still in Beta, with a commitment to launch Frugal 3.5.5 within a week of the official WordPress 3.0 release. Though there was nothing major, the WordPress Team did make some last minute changes to the WordPress 3.0 code. We’ve made adjustments to Frugal accordingly, and are happy to announce that Frugal is now even more totally WordPress 3.0 compatible than ever before with the launch of Frugal version 3.5.5!
